Offer Flexible Payment Plans

Flexible payment plans allow customers to pay off their vehicles over a period of time that works best for them—whether that’s weekly, monthly, or bi-weekly payments. Flexible payment plans should be set with these things in mind:

Interest rates

The interest rate should be competitive and reasonable for the customer. If a customer feels as though they’re being charged too much in interest, it may encourage them to default on their payments.

Late fees

Late fees should also be reasonable. Charging customers an exorbitant amount of late fees can cause financial hardship, leading them to default on their payments. Additionally, late fees should be communicated clearly to customers so they’re aware of what will happen if payments are not made on time.

Convenience

It should be easy for customers to make their payments online or via other convenient methods. Additionally, payments should be accepted in a timely manner to avoid any additional late fees or other penalties.

Automatic deductions

You can also set up automatic payment deductions from the customer’s bank account. This ensures that payments are made on time, avoiding any late fees and potential defaults.

Flexible payment plans will not only help keep customers on track with their loan payments, but they will also make them feel more secure, knowing that they have the ability to break up their payments over time instead of having to pay one large lump sum all at once.

Utilize Buy Here Pay Here GPS Tracking

GPS tracking technology for Buy Here Pay Here (BHPH) dealerships ensures customers meet their payment plan requirements. This method of tracking gives BHPH dealerships an extra level of control. It safeguards the financial relationship between buyer and seller. GPS-enabled devices in vehicles allow these businesses to keep track of whereabouts, making it easier to stay informed about where vehicles are located, as well as prevent customers from selling or trading them without notice or permission.

It has become a widely effective means of managing customer payment defaults, which can significantly reduce risks related to investments made by the dealership. In addition, GPS tracking systems also provide detailed reports on vehicle usage and performance for better decision-making, allowing BHPH dealerships to maximize their profits.

Offer Incentives for On-Time Payments

Incentives can go a long way when it comes to encouraging on-time payments from customers. Offering discounts or special offers for those who make their payments on time can help encourage people to stay on top of their loans by giving them an extra incentive to do so. These incentives can range from free oil changes or car washes, discounts on repairs or maintenance services, or even cash bonuses!
